Output 221ceaa85074503532ccfc1d528548c66cb1780cb02b5618f7a52a02d84b8f52:8

value
2943310
script pubkey
OP_0 OP_PUSHBYTES_20 2628e3a31fce87d4acf3645007f7ae3e375cb1ae
address
bc1qyc5w8gcle6raft8nv3gq0aaw8cm4evdwp2wn9d
transaction
221ceaa85074503532ccfc1d528548c66cb1780cb02b5618f7a52a02d84b8f52